U.K. unemployment is expected to have stayed stable in September. The set of labor data for this month is expected to have been quite undramatic with very little movement in the key figures, noted Societe Generale in a research note. Given that the real economic activity is temporarily resilient, employment looks set to continue for some months yet and joblessness is therefore likely to be stable.
There is likelihood of a small decline of 2000 in the claimant count in October after a small rise of 0.7k in September, stated Societe Generale. The LFS jobless rate is expected to have remained at hold at 4.9 percent in the three months to September. Also, the earnings figures are likely to have remained stable in the same period with both total and regular earnings growth staying at 2.3 percent three-month year-on-year, the same as in last month, added Societe Generale.
